Canadian Pacific Kansas City Limited (CP) shares closed at $86.26, down 0.52% in the latest session. The stock continues to trade within a defined range, with established support near $81.95 and resistance at $90.57, as investors weigh broader transportation sector trends.

The modest decline in CP's price occurred on what appeared to be normal trading activity, with volume patterns suggesting routine profit-taking rather than a significant shift in sentiment. The transportation sector has experienced mixed performance recently, with rail stocks facing headwinds from softer industrial demand and ongoing supply chain adjustments. CP’s 0.52% drop aligns with a broader cautious tone among railway operators, though the magnitude remains contained relative to some peers. Key drivers behind the move include renewed uncertainty about North American freight volumes, as economic data points to a slowdown in manufacturing activity. Additionally, investors may be reacting to regulatory developments or competitive dynamics within the rail industry, though no company-specific catalyst was evident in the session. The stock’s price action reflects a market that is carefully balancing near-term headwinds against CP’s long-term strategic advantages, including its expansive network spanning Canada, the United States, and Mexico. With the stock trading at $86.26, it sits below its 52-week high, suggesting that broader macroeconomic concerns continue to weigh on valuation. From a technical perspective, CP’s price action currently suggests a consolidation phase between the identified support at $81.95 and resistance at $90.57. The stock has oscillated within this band over recent weeks, failing to decisively breach either boundary. The 0.52% decline brings the price closer to the midpoint of this range, indicating a lack of directional conviction among traders. Regarding technical indicators, the relative strength index (RSI) appears to be in the mid-40s range, pointing to slightly bearish momentum without reaching oversold territory. Short-term moving averages, such as the 50-day, may be hovering near the current price level, potentially offering immediate resistance. The longer-term 200-day moving average likely lies above the resistance zone, reinforcing the significance of the $90.57 level. Volume patterns during the decline were consistent with typical daily activity, failing to confirm a breakout or breakdown. A move toward the $81.95 support could attract buyers if the broader market remains stable, while a rally above $90.57 would require stronger volume and a catalyst such as improved earnings guidance or favorable rail traffic data. If the stock holds above the $81.95 support level, it could continue to trade within its current range, potentially finding buying interest near the lower boundary. Conversely, a sustained break below $81.95 might open the door to further downside, possibly testing the next major support zone. On the upside, a move toward $90.57 would likely require a positive catalyst—such as stronger-than-expected quarterly results, a rebound in industrial production, or improved cross-border trade dynamics. Broader market conditions will also play a role: interest rate expectations, inflation data, and geopolitical developments could shift investor sentiment toward or away from cyclical sectors like transportation. Additionally, any updates regarding CP’s operational efficiency or cost management efforts could serve as a near-term driver. While the stock’s current price reflects a cautious outlook, its long-term network advantages and exposure to growing trade corridors may provide a foundation for recovery. Investors should monitor volume patterns and price action around the key support and resistance levels for clues about the next move.
